Sullivan County, New York, distinguishes itself as the historic home of the 1969 Woodstock Festival, a legacy honored today by the Bethel Woods Center for the Arts. Located in the Catskill Mountains, about 90 minutes northwest of New York City, the county offers a blend of rural charm and natural beauty. Rolling hills, lakes, and the Delaware River provide extensive outdoor recreation opportunities, including hiking, fishing, kayaking, and camping. Towns like Livingston Manor, Roscoe, Callicoon, and Narrowsburg feature local shops, art galleries, and farm-to-table dining, contributing to a community atmosphere.
Life in Sullivan County attracts a mix of residents, including those seeking a quieter lifestyle, remote workers, and families. The county's public school districts include Eldred, Fallsburg, Liberty, Livingston Manor, Monticello, Roscoe, Sullivan West, and Tri-Valley. Commute times to New York City by car are around two hours, with bus services also available. The economy is seeing new investments, particularly in sectors such as professional and business services, private education and health services, and leisure and hospitality. The Sullivan County International Airport has also undergone modernization, aiming to support tourism and economic growth.

Sullivan County has a Boom Town Index score of 64/100, ranking #355 among 996 U.S. counties. With job growth at +0.3% and a median household income of $67,841, it's an above-average county on economic indicators.
The median home value in Sullivan County is $220,200 with median rent at $996/month. The income-to-home-value ratio is 0.3081, which is more affordable than the national average.
Population growth: +0.6% year-over-year. Job growth: +0.3%. Home values changed +1.5% in the past 12 months.
